Driving Test Booking Administration Fee (Effective 27 October 2025)

Due to the continued shortage of DVSA driving test availability and the time required to secure suitable dates, Lernin Driving School operates a Driving Test Booking Assistance Service.

  • A £20 administration fee applies only once a driving test has been successfully secured on your behalf.

  • No specific date or time preferences can be requested due to the limited and unpredictable nature of DVSA test releases.

  • Once a test has been secured, any requested amendments (including date, time, or test centre changes) will incur an additional £10 administration fee per change.

  • This charge covers the instructor’s time spent actively monitoring the DVSA booking system — including early-morning checks and repeated attempts to secure suitable cancellations — which often takes place outside normal working hours.

This service is optional. Pupils who prefer to manage their own test bookings may do so directly via the official DVSA booking service.
